
Adaptive Optics
Adaptive Optics is a technology used in space and astronautical engineering to improve the performance of optical systems by reducing the effects of atmospheric distortion. It works by measuring the distortion caused by the atmosphere and then using a deformable mirror to correct for it in real-time. This technology is used in telescopes, laser communication systems, and imaging systems to improve image resolution and reduce blur caused by atmospheric turbulence.
